Ingredients Serving: 10

  1. Maida / All purpose flour - 2 cups
  2. Warm water - less than 1/4 cup
  3. Oil - 1/3 cup
  4. Butter - 4 tbsp (melted )
  5. Baking soda - 1 tsp
  6. Milk powder - 1 tbsp (optional )
  7. White Sesame seeds - 4 tsp
  8. Onion - 1 big, finely chopped
  9. Green Chillies - 3-4, finely chopped
  10. Pepper powder - 1 tsp ( optional )
  11. Coriander leaves - handful
  12. Curry leaves few
  13. Sugar - 2 tsp
  14. Salt to taste

Instructions

  1. Take maida, oil and butter in a bowl. Mix nicely with the tips of your fingers. It will become like breadcrumb.
  2. To the flour add milk powder, baking soda, salt ,sugar , pepper powder , sesame seeds, onion, green chillies , coriander leaves and curry leaves . Mix the ingredients nicely with your hand.
  3. Add warm water slowly in steps and make a tight dough .Even if you feel dough is very tight , don't add water now. When the dough rests for few minutes, moisture from onion will make the dough a bit loose. So remember not to add extra water.
  4. Knead the dough well ,cover and keep aside for 10-15 mins. Meanwhile preheat the oven at 180 degree c for 10 mins.
  5. Once the resting time for dough is over, divide the dough into lemon sized balls. Take 1 ball, place it in between 2 thick greased plastic sheets and roll gently to form a poori size thin disc.
  6. Gently place the nippattu on a greased baking tray. Poke the nippattu with a fork randomly to avoid fluffing up.
  7. Continue with the remaining dough in a similar way. Bake the nippattu for about 15-20 mins in 170 deg c . Midway flip once after 10 mins. Once done, place them on a cooling rack to cool .
  8. Store in air tight containers. Stays crisp for at least 15-20 days.
